Pam Grossman is a writer, curator, and teacher of magical practice and history. She is the host of the internationally beloved podcast The Witch Wave and the author of Magic Maker: The Enchanted Path to Creativity,Waking the Witch, and What Is A Witch. She is also coeditor and coauthor of the Witchcraft volume of Taschen’s Library of Esoterica series. Her writing has appeared in numerous media outlets, including The New York Times, The Atlantic, and Ms. Magazine, and she has been a featured speaker at venues including MoMA: The Museum of Modern Art, Columbia University, and IFC Center. She is co-organizer of the biennial Occult Humanities Conference at NYU, and her workshops on spellcraft, creativity, and occult history have been attended by thousands of students around the world.
